The causes of train derailments
Derailments on trains are extremely hazardous for both passengers and residents nearby. They can result in serious injuries, deaths, and environmental destruction. According to a study conducted by the Eno Center for Transportation, while human error and speed are the leading causes of derailment, many factors can be responsible for them. Some of these factors include defective equipment, track defects and weather conditions that cause expansion and contraction of the tracks. Other causes of train accidents include collisions with cars at railroad crossings, trespassing, and trains colliding.
The majority of train derailments happen outside of rail yards. When they do occur, they usually involve trains carrying hazardous chemicals or materials that can spill onto the tracks and into local water supplies like what happened when a train was tipped over in East Palestine, Ohio earlier this year. A few of these train crashes also cause damage to buildings and other structures that are near the tracks and also injure hundreds or even thousands of people.
A collision with another vehicle is the most frequent cause of a train derailing. The driver may be distracted by a mobile phone, be under influence of alcohol or drugs or simply not paying attention to their surroundings. They could fail to yield or stop at a rail crossing or misjudge the speed of turning.
The equipment that is not working properly is the next in line for derailments. This can include faulty or damaged wheels, locomotive bearings and car bearings. It can also refer to problems with switches or tracks, as well as an inability to keep the railroad free of foreign objects on the tracks.
The weather conditions can also contribute to train derailments. High temperatures can cause the track to expand and contract, while high winds can cause snow avalanches and debris to fall on the tracks. This can result in uneven or bumpy tracks, increasing the risk of derailments on trains. However, train conductors should always be aware of their surroundings and examine the tracks frequently for any obstacles or defects.
